Default Cheap 5 3/4 inch headlight housings....beware

Purchased what was advertised as a 5 3/4 inch headlight housing off Ebay... less than 100.00....figured this would be a fine alternative to a Headwinds or Adjure....Also, it came with the headlamp....so i figured, what the heck

well, turns out that the mount and hardware were metric, as well as the diameter housing the lamp...i intended on changing out the mount because it was just so cheap...BUT, of course, a standard sized mount width of 3/4 was a hair too wide ...also, I wanted to get rid of the cheap lamp in the housing..BUT, not happening.... standard 5 3/4 lamps would NOT fit inside the housing...again, just a hair too big in diameter

point is, you WILL get what you pay for in headlights... it'll either be cheap in quality and will no doubt be an "off shore" item with incorrect dimensions all around

I'm off to Adjure or Headwinds!

I'd like to say, that is not always the case.

I too like a lot of others out there, hate the Dyna headlight. It's too receesed and too small front to back.

I looked around A LOT and finally found exactly what i was looking for: the 310-332 Drag Specialties chrome 5 3/4 diamter headlight. For 60 bucks and a bit more change for shipping, it went on with ease - once you figure out how to correlate the wiring (different color wires from stock).

Looks great on the bike to boot - like it belongs there.

that's not what i'm saying, flynavy.... the headlight i got would have gone on with ease, as well.....but when i decided to change the mount and the lamp i ran into problems .....i would have had no problem with wiring, as it took the standard H4 bulb...wiring and installation was not the issue....compatibility with standard american sizes WAS, as they related to the mount and lamp
